How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    We are seeking an experienced Engineering Geologist with a strong commercial mindset and proven ability to manage site investigations and drilling operations. This is a key role within a growing team, offering the opportunity to take ownership of projects from initial scoping through to delivery, while also contributing to client engagement and commercial performance.


    The ideal candidate will have consultancy experience and be comfortable balancing technical delivery with site management, cost awareness, and client interaction.


    Key responsibilities include managing and supervising site investigations and drilling operations, including subcontractor and drilling crews. You will be responsible for planning, coordinating, and overseeing geotechnical and geo-environmental fieldwork campaigns, ensuring works are delivered safely, on time, and within budget.


    The role involves liaising directly with clients, contractors, and internal project teams, as well as preparing site documentation such as risk assessments, method statements, and field reports. You will also contribute to the interpretation of ground conditions and assist with both factual and interpretative reporting, while supporting project costing, budgeting, and commercial tracking. In addition, you will play a role in developing and maintaining client relationships and ensuring compliance with relevant industry standards and health and safety regulations.


    The successful candidate should have proven experience as an Engineering Geologist within a consultancy environment, along with strong experience managing site investigations and drilling crews. A solid understanding of geotechnical and geo-environmental ground investigation techniques is essential, along with commercial awareness and the ability to support project delivery from a cost perspective. Strong communication and client-facing skills are required, as well as the ability to manage multiple projects and deadlines. A full UK driving licence is also essential.


    Experience in both residential and commercial ground investigation projects would be beneficial, as would exposure to cost control, quotations, or broader project management responsibilities. Experience working closely with engineers, contractors, and external stakeholders would also be advantageous.


    This is an opportunity to take ownership of varied and technically interesting projects within a growing consultancy, with strong progression potential and exposure to both technical and commercial aspects of delivery.


    The role offers a competitive salary and benefits package.
